By combining AI-driven reverse engineering with eco-friendly solvents, scientists are redefining the future of perovskite solar cells, delivering affordable, low-carbon energy for global deployment.

Korean researchers have unveiled an AI-powered roadmap for sustainable perovskite solar cells that halves production costs and cuts climate impact by over 80%. Their bio-based process replaces toxic solvents, making solar power safer, cheaper, and greener.

A breakthrough AI framework that isolates diseased leaf regions is setting new standards for plant disease assessment, helping farmers cut costs, reduce pesticide use, and protect global food security. https://www.azoai.com/news/20250922/New-AI-Framework-LLRL-Accurately-Detects-Plant-Disease-Severity-for-Smarter-Farming.aspx

Researchers at Guizhou University have developed LLRL, a deep learning framework that targets lesion regions directly, boosting the accuracy of plant disease severity assessment across apple, potato, and tomato leaves. The model achieved up to 92.4% accuracy, outperforming 12 benchmark approaches.

A new UW study finds Community Notes on X significantly curb engagement with misinformation, yet their effectiveness depends on speed, scale, and whether other platforms adopt similar transparency measures.

A University of Washington-led study shows that Community Notes on X reduce virality by cutting reposts by 46% and likes by 44%. The findings suggest the feature slows misinformation spread, but speed and cross-platform collaboration remain critical challenges.

A breakthrough AI model trained on unlabeled seismic data promises to revolutionize earthquake monitoring, turning everyday fiber-optic cables into a dense, global seismic intelligence network.

Scientists have unveiled DASFormer, a self-supervised AI model that transforms fiber-optic cables into powerful earthquake monitoring tools. By learning from unlabeled seismic data, it detects earthquakes as anomalies, outperforming 22 state-of-the-art models in real-world tests.

A breakthrough light-based chip could revolutionize AI by cutting energy demands while preserving high performance, paving the way for faster and greener computing systems.

Researchers at University of Florida have created a silicon chip that uses laser light and microscopic Fresnel lenses to perform convolution operations, a power-intensive step in AI. This optical approach greatly reduces energy use while maintaining near 98% accuracy in machine learning tasks.
